Will quit politics if allegations proved against me or family: Rajnath Singh

New Delhi, Aug 27 (ANI): Union Home Minister Rajnath Singh on Wednesday said that the rumors being spread about his son are all fake and baseless. He assured the public that if any allegations against him or his family member are proved to be true he will quit politics forever and stay at home. Former Maharashtra Governor K Sankaranarayanan receives guard of honour

Mumbai, Aug 27 (ANI): Former Maharashtra Governor K Sankaranarayanan received farewell by state cabinet staffs and ministers at Sahyadri Guest House in Mumbai on Wednesday. Sankaranarayanan also received guard of honour during the event. Present at the occasion were ministers and state Chief Minister Prithviraj Chavan who bid farewell to the former governor. Sankaranarayanan resigned soon after he was transferred to Mizoram by the NDA government for his remaining tenure, which had to end in 2017. He has said that he would no longer wish to be a Governor bearing the "disgrace of being transferred." Aug 27, 2014

SC dismisses petition on appointment of tainted ministers, says its call of framers of Constitution

New Delhi, Aug 27 (ANI): The Supreme Court on Wednesday dismissed petition seeking the removal of Cabinet ministers with criminal background. The SC said that it is the call of the ‘framers of Constitution’ or the Prime Minister and the Chief Ministers of the state to see who they are appointing. The petition was heard by a bench comprising of the Chief Justice of India and five other judges. The Supreme Court has however clarified its stand on ministers with criminal background saying that, "Those in conflict with the law and involved in offences of moral turpitude and corruption should not be allowed to discharge duty as ministers". Delhi swelters under heat wave in month of August

New Delhi, Aug 27 (ANI): Indian Meteorological department Director BP Yadav said that relief from sweltering heat will come only by the end of the month. This came as Delhi witnessed the hottest day in the month of August after twelve years on Monday. Yadav explained the cause of the heat wave. Earlier, an official had said that a combination of urbanisation, extensive use of concrete and more cars did appear to be changing micro climates within and near cities, exacerbating the impact of heat waves.
